>> If an exception occurs on ARM or x86, we call panic() which will try to
>> reset the board. Do the same on RISC-V.
>>
>> To avoid -Werror=format-zero-length move a '\n' to the string passed to
>> panic. We don't need a message here as depending on CONFIG_PANIC_HANG we
>> will either see
>>
>>     ### ERROR ### Please RESET the board ###
>>
>> or
>>
>>     resetting ...
>>
>> as next message.
